Alex.IGN
Profile Joined March 2011
United States1050 Posts
September 10 2011 23:08 GMT
#219
On September 11 2011 08:06 bucckevin wrote:
Show nested quote +
On September 11 2011 07:49 Canucklehead wrote:
On September 11 2011 07:45 Vehemus wrote:
IGN, these brackets should not be spoiled ahead of time.

I enjoy watching your content and I also enjoy you being forthcoming about the winners of the qualifiers but you'd get twice as many people watching the qualifiers if people didn't actually already know the outcome of every game.

It's absolutely human nature to care less about something competitive if you already know the outcome. It's the reason people will go so far out of their way to avoid spoilers of a football game they couldn't watch but are going to go home later for on their DVR. Or avoid all their favorite forums until they watch the GSL finals because they don't want them spoiled.

I understand you can't do the qualifiers live, I understand that I don't have to check to see who won if I don't want to, and I understand that people will probably find a way to find out through match histories who won anyway.

But damn, these players and games are awesome, why do you tell us who won every match a week before we get to watch them? My two cents.


Because they tried to hide results from qualifier 1 and the results got leaked right away. They realized it's pointless to try to hide results since then and most people want to know who qualified, so it's better to give live results.


Not only that, an overwhelming number of people requested that the bracket results be released.


This right here.

If we were doing an online tournament we would of course hide the results.

But this is a qualifier for a live event. A live event that we want people to go to. If it helps someone make a decision to go to IPL 3 because MMA or Stephano qualified we want to make it as easy and cheap for them as possible by releasing the information asap, rather then waiting a week to reveal it and making someone buy a more expensive plane ticket.
